Patents by Inventor Weigang BAI

Weigang BAI has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11934314
    Abstract: A method of copying at least first and second files stored in a client computing device to a host server, includes the steps of: generating at the host server a first read I/O request for data of the first file based on responses to pre-read I/O requests for the first file, received from the client computing device; transmitting a merged I/O request that includes the first read I/O request for data of the first file and pre-read I/O requests for the second file from the host server to the client computing device; generating at the host server a second read I/O request for data of the second file based on responses to the pre-read I/O requests for the second file, received from the client computing device; and transmitting the second read I/O request for data of the second file from the host server to the client computing device.
    Type: Grant
    Filed: September 1, 2022
    Date of Patent: March 19, 2024
    Assignee: VMware LLC
    Inventors: Wu Bai, Haiwei Zhao, Weigang Huang, Feng Yan, Kun Shi
  • Publication number: 20230216806
    Abstract: A large-scale network node simulation method based on Linux container is provided, which solves problems of low packet transmission efficiency and multi-thread creation in real-time simulation in a large-scale network scenario. The method includes: scheduling all container nodes in a scenario; managing, by a container node, a dynamic thread through an idle thread management queue, and setting a finite state machine and a function pointer for the dynamic thread; registering, by a source container node, an output queue with a next-hop container node, and informing the next-hop container node to allocate a dynamic thread for receiving and processing the output queue. Packet transmission is realized between the container nodes through data units created in a shared memory. The sending thread and the receiving thread dynamically adjust the number of dynamic threads by checking the state of the output queue.
    Type: Application
    Filed: December 30, 2022
    Publication date: July 6, 2023
    Inventors: Yan SHI, Min SHENG, Qixuan CAO, Jiandong LI, Weigang BAI, Di ZHOU, Haoran LI, Yan ZHU, Feng DING, Lianwei ZHOU
  • Publication number: 20220353742
    Abstract: Hierarchical network operation and resource control system and method for a mega satellite constellation, belonging to the field of spatial information technology, are provided. The hierarchical network operation and resource control system includes a service layer, a global organization layer, a local coordination layer and a resource layer. The service layer is used as an input to drive operation of whole system. The global organization layer is to realize “operation, measurement and control” integrated control and decision of whole network. The local coordination layer is to realize local management decision and management slice generation. The resource layer is to provide physical resource and physical device and realize resource virtualization.
    Type: Application
    Filed: April 19, 2022
    Publication date: November 3, 2022
    Inventors: Min SHENG, Di ZHOU, Sijing JI, Weigang BAI, Jiandong LI, Yan SHI, Haoran LI
  • Publication number: 20220345967
    Abstract: Lightweight inter-satellite handover device and method for a mega LEO satellite network are provided. An attribute extraction sub-module extracts attributes of handover users in a user information storage unit. Based on the attributes of the handover users, a cluster sub-module clusters the handover users into user clusters. A decision set generator sub-module generates target satellite sets of the user clusters, determines each target satellite of the target satellite sets of the user clusters of each LEO satellite whether belongs to LEO satellites in a management domain of a handover decision point of managing the LEO satellite based on management domain information in a LEO satellite information storage unit, and if YES, performing inter-satellite handover by a centralized decision unit, otherwise performing inter-satellite handover by a distributed decision unit.
    Type: Application
    Filed: April 18, 2022
    Publication date: October 27, 2022
    Inventors: Min SHENG, Di ZHOU, Liuying WANG, Sijing JI, Jiandong LI, Weigang BAI, Yan SHI, Haoran LI